Crontab operation not permitted. 9k次,点赞4次...
Crontab operation not permitted. 9k次,点赞4次,收藏5次。本文介绍了在Linux环境中使用cron定时任务执行shell脚本时遇到的'Operation not permitted'错误,以及如何通过赋予cron全磁盘访问权限来解决问题。详细步骤包括在系统偏好设置中添加cron到完全磁盘访问权限列表。 Operation not permitted while trying to run script through crontab - Mac Asked 5 years, 3 months ago Modified 4 years, 8 months ago Viewed 2k times I put this script in a cron job in my macOS Big Sur, but kept getting Operation not permitted" error in my macOS Big Sur machine. To resolve this, ensure the script has executable permissions using the "chmod +x" command. While there are numerous reasons a cronjob may fail, strict security measures in the latest MacOS releases may also be at fault and cause problems for some users. sh on my Desktop (which has #!/bin/bash in the beginning of the file). I have seen here various issues about the crontab ' Operation not permitted ' issue for Mac OS, but I seem to have a more complex situation on my hands. Unable to edit crontab with non-root users: [user@server ~]$ crontab -e crontab: installing new crontab chown: Operation not permitted crontab: edits left in /tmp/crontab. However, the cron failed start with error: seteuid: Operation not permitted I have already done the following settin Jan 25, 2024 · I issued the crontab -e command to add a cron job to my user’s crontab file, modified and saved it, only to the following error: crontab: installing new crontab crontab: crontabs/<user>: rename: Operation not permitted crontab: edits left in /tmp/crontab. g. 1 root root 53472 Jun 11 2013 /usr/bin/crontab Notice the rws This is the setuid (set user id) bit. sh script that writes to a drive, it often stems from the script lacking the necessary permissions. Dec 29, 2019 · Why is operation not permitted event though the permissions for cronjob. It sounds like whatever user is running the Cron job does not have access to your documents, folder. Unlike that computer, any sudo change I try to do below /private/var/at (e. heartbeat skipped with reason=quiet-hours → outside active hours window. Dec 20, 2023 · We use open-shift, and the docker container only could be run as non-root user. heartbeat: unknown accountId → invalid account id for heartbeat delivery target. Processing triggers for man-db I have upgraded Ubuntu from 20. hgmsOH/crontab Puzzled, I checked whether my user permissions were all right, if the disk Dec 12, 2023 · I was running cron jobs that worked with macOS Mojave, Catalina, Big Sur, Monterey, and Ventura but stopped working after I updated to macOS Sonoma. /usr/bin/crontab' before installing new version: Operation not permitted configured to not write apport reports chown: changing ownership of `root': Operation not permitted chmod: changing permissions of `root': Operation not permitted Starting periodic command scheduler: cron. XXXXIiFpBT [user@server ~]$ crontab -l Authentication failure You (user) are not allowed to access to (crontab) because of pam configuration. Configurations I added: Created the file untitled. sh is set to +x? Dec 28, 2023 · In macOS Sonoma, when encountering "Operation not permitted" while attempting to allow crontab to run a . Mar 17 16:21:09 xxxx crontab: User account has expired cron: scheduler disabled; jobs will not run automatically → cron disabled. My user is a member of both cron and 报错原因是cron文件管理器没有执行权限,在隐私里面设置即可 今天写了个shell脚本想用定时任务每半小时执行一次 */30 * * * * cd /Users/xxxx/Desktop/ && sh test. I'm running vixie-cron 4. As the root user you will need to use the chmod command to change it to -rwsr-xr-x. 04 to 22. I have a bash file on the desktop, which I wanna execute in crontab. log 结果生成了一个空的cron. 1-r10 on Gentoo Linux. cron: timer tick failed → scheduler tick failed; check file/log/runtime errors. bash and Terminal are not the users in this case. sudo touch test) gets "Operation not permitted". sh >>crontab. Related: /automation Errno 1: Operation not permitted while running cron job in crontab Asked 5 years, 3 months ago Modified 5 years, 3 months ago Viewed 2k times unable to make backup link of `. 04 but the upgrade doesn't seem to have completed successfully. When I try to install a new package, as an example: sudo apt install virtualenv I get the fol 37 I was able to get my crontab (which calls python) back on track by giving /usr/sbin/cron "Full Disk Access". It's important to note that simple cron jobs were still executing, but my python based jobs were returning "Operation not permitted". Apr 27, 2020 · Depending on the situation, this may be accompanied by a permissions error, an operation not permitted error, or a script or cronjob may simply fail silently in the background. 文章浏览阅读1. On /private/var and above, i am able to sudo change anything (as in the limited and obvious type of changes i tested inside /private/var/at, not anything). Resolved. Here are two sample errors. I don’t use cron, so I’m not sure, but I think cron runs as root, and root probably doesn’t have access to your Desktop, Documents, and Downloads folder per Ventura’s privacy model. I'm having trouble getting cron to be usable by normal users. g1rq, rrlnj, mweab, 9c5gau, mtmkps, jqmbn, ngbl, zp9o, rq9yvk, z6vs,